We are seeking a Senior .NET Developer to join our development team. The ideal candidate will have extensive experience in .NET framework, C#, and web development. You will be responsible for designing, developing, and maintaining high-quality software solutions.
Key Responsibilities:
- Develop and maintain .NET applications.
- Write clean, efficient, and well-documented code.
- Participate in code reviews and testing.
- Collaborate with other developers and stakeholders.
- Troubleshoot and resolve software defects.
Required Skills:
- Proficiency in .NET framework and C#.
- Experience with web development technologies (e.g., ASP.NET, MVC).
- Knowledge of database systems (e.g., SQL Server).
- Experience with software development methodologies (e.g., Agile).